Nota
Grupos y proyectos son términos sinónimos. Tu {PROJECT-ID} es lo mismo que tu ID del grupo. Para los grupos existentes, su identificador de grupo/proyecto sigue siendo el mismo. Esta página utiliza el término más familiar "grupo" al referirse a descripciones. El endpoint permanece como se indica en el documento.
URL base: https://{OPSMANAGER-HOST}:{PORT}/api/public/v1.0
El hosts recurso define los procesos mongod y mongos en la implementación. Cada proceso se identifica mediante una combinación única de nombre de host y puerto. Cuando agregue un mongod o un mongos a Ops Manager, Ops Manager descubre automáticamente varias combinaciones válidas de nombre de host y puerto para el proceso. Los registros DNS son los nombres que se pueden usar para acceder a un host determinado. Ops Manager clasifica los nombres de host para elegir un nombre de host «primario». Los nombres de host con más puntos ocupan los primeros puestos, mientras que la dirección de bucle invertido (127.0.0.1) y localhost ocupan los últimos puestos. Ops Manager trata los nombres de host "perdedores" como alias de host.
Cuando el Ops Manager recibe un ping de la supervisión, se repite el algoritmo para asignar un nombre de host primario. Como resultado, el hostname principal puede cambiar con el tiempo. También puedes especifica los hostnames preferidos en la configuración del proyecto de Ops Manager para sobrescribir el algoritmo de hostname.
Extremos
Los siguientes puntos finales están disponibles para hosts.
Método | Endpoint | Descripción |
|---|---|---|
OBTENER | Se obtienen todos los procesos de MongoDB en un proyecto. | |
OBTENER | Obtén un proceso de MongoDB por ID de host. | |
OBTENER | Obtener un único proceso de MongoDB por su nombre de host y puerto. | |
publicación | Empieza a monitorear un nuevo proceso de MongoDB. | |
PATCH | Actualizar la configuración de un proceso de MongoDB supervisado. | |
Borrar | Detener la supervisión de un proceso de MongoDB. |